William Casarin [ARCHIVE] on Nostr: š
Original date posted:2018-12-29 š Original message: Pavol Rusnak via ...
š
Original date posted:2018-12-29
š Original message:
Pavol Rusnak via Lightning-dev <lightning-dev at lists.linuxfoundation.org>
writes:
> Hi all!
>
> Currently, when I perform a payment via QR code, I usually check the
> payee node id (public key) in the send dialog. However, this is a rather
> long hex value, so for example Eclair app shows just the beginning and
> the end of the value.
>
> Idea: Can we show an identicon (for example
https://jdenticon.com/) of
> payee node id (= public key) next to the QR code, so user can visually
> quickly check whether the recipient is correct?
I think it would be interesting if someone came up with a visual hashing
algorithm, where small changes in the inputs had uniformly random visual
outputs. I was testing jdenticon with my node id:
03f3c108ccd536b8526841f0a5c58212bb9e6584a1eb493080e7c1cc34f82dad71
I was surprised to see that small changes to the first digit didn't
change the visual output at all. Whether or not this is a useful
property in this use case, it's something to keep in mind.
Cheers,
Will
--
https://jb55.comPublished at
2023-06-09 12:53:35Event JSON
{
"id": "edf5e06b72c7e5737a64705776a0696b7c85619b76f4ddc2a6d47996b3eb96fa",
"pubkey": "6fb2fd1f8df298fef3464d220666d5ae7184dfe89dc5cc7d3a177579986c31cb",
"created_at": 1686315215,
"kind": 1,
"tags": [
[
"e",
"6dd6fccbb2615547ca5b22d8df02fc7011c536332a6a0605c562d03d76b76ef2",
"",
"root"
],
[
"e",
"0539f96caf3a7e1fccc1c08faa952e43e98ab350512e07684e3cc2bc09581b4f",
"",
"reply"
],
[
"p",
"7631397e469f47f3535567311f5f7c17129e0ff2cb253df015e3d92ddfd92c63"
]
],
"content": "š
Original date posted:2018-12-29\nš Original message:\nPavol Rusnak via Lightning-dev \u003clightning-dev at lists.linuxfoundation.org\u003e\nwrites:\n\n\u003e Hi all!\n\u003e\n\u003e Currently, when I perform a payment via QR code, I usually check the\n\u003e payee node id (public key) in the send dialog. However, this is a rather\n\u003e long hex value, so for example Eclair app shows just the beginning and\n\u003e the end of the value.\n\u003e\n\u003e Idea: Can we show an identicon (for example https://jdenticon.com/) of\n\u003e payee node id (= public key) next to the QR code, so user can visually\n\u003e quickly check whether the recipient is correct?\n\nI think it would be interesting if someone came up with a visual hashing\nalgorithm, where small changes in the inputs had uniformly random visual\noutputs. I was testing jdenticon with my node id:\n\n 03f3c108ccd536b8526841f0a5c58212bb9e6584a1eb493080e7c1cc34f82dad71\n\nI was surprised to see that small changes to the first digit didn't\nchange the visual output at all. Whether or not this is a useful\nproperty in this use case, it's something to keep in mind.\n\nCheers,\nWill\n\n-- \nhttps://jb55.com",
"sig": "b3b803aa8b7580e33a35bb3f49b7cf0940b460e38564702e932f39f88333ad801db727fcef788a03e57b83658427c8a433271a5da0416180b7c4e57ae606df7c"
}